F&I Manager Training

A dealership's F&I Manager is responsible for finding a financing program that is the right fit for every customer who wishes to purchase a vehicle. Without the right financing, the customer may change their mind about buying the Powersports vehicle they've been discussing with your agent.

After-market products like extended service contracts, battery replacement plans, tire and wheel coverage, and other F&I programs boost a dealership's profits. These not only mean profits from the F&I purchases made, but also from the services availed at the dealership through the F&I programs the customer purchased. For every service received at the dealership, they are entitled to a portion of the claims as payment for their services.

Understand, however, that the above depends on the agreement between the F&I third-party provider and the dealership.

Powersports F&I training solutions

As you can see, the F&I Manager plays a huge role in driving a dealership's profits. For this reason, they need to undergo regular training to ensure their skills are up to par with industry standards and with consumers' ever-evolving buying behavior. From these F&I trainings, they learn about changes in their state's regulations regarding insurance and F&I contracts as well as other such relevant laws and rules.

Today's consumers are becoming more dependent on technology, so much so that purchases, research, and communications are done online. Is your F&I team tech-savvy? It's important to have skills that enable them to better serve your customers.

Powersports F&I trainings may last anywhere from one day to two days, sometimes five days, or even longer for some. It all depends on the topics and coverage of the training.
